One notable innovation is the development of mobile crushing plants. Traditionally, crushing equipment was fixed in one location, requiring the transportation of materials to the site. Mobile crushing plants eliminate this need by being capable of moving to various sites, allowing for increased flexibility and reducing transportation costs. These plants often come equipped with advanced features such as wireless remote control and intelligent PLC systems, enabling operators to easily adjust settings and monitor performance.

Another significant innovation is the introduction of automated crushers. Automation technology has transformed many industries, and the crushing production line is no exception. Automated crushers are equipped with sensors and monitoring systems that control and optimize the crushing process. These systems constantly monitor various parameters such as the feed rate, material hardness, and crusher chamber conditions, adjusting the settings accordingly to maximize productivity and minimize wear and energy consumption. This automation enhances operational efficiency and reduces the need for manual intervention, thereby increasing safety and reducing the risk of human error.

In recent years, there has also been a focus on improving the environmental sustainability of crushing production line equipment. Many manufacturers are developing crushers that are more energy-efficient and produce less noise and dust. For example, advanced dust suppression systems are being integrated into crushing equipment, reducing the release of harmful particles into the air. Some crushers even utilize innovative technologies such as electric or hybrid powertrains, further reducing carbon emissions and fuel consumption.

Furthermore, advancements in material science have influenced the innovation of new wear parts for crushing equipment. Manufacturers are now utilizing hard-wearing materials, such as high-chrome alloys and ceramics, for the construction of crusher components like liners, blow bars, and hammers. These materials exhibit superior wear resistance and longevity, resulting in longer-lasting wear parts and reduced maintenance requirements. This, in turn, increases overall machine uptime and reduces the costs associated with frequent replacements.

Additionally, digitalization and data analytics have transformed the way crushing production line equipment is operated and maintained. Manufacturers are incorporating advanced sensor technology and data analytics platforms into their equipment, allowing operators to monitor and analyze key performance indicators. This valuable information can be used to make data-driven decisions and optimize the crushing process. Predictive maintenance algorithms can also be implemented, detecting potential failures before they occur, thereby preventing unplanned downtime and reducing maintenance costs.
